Monero (XMR) is a decentralized, untraceable digital currency designed to provide secure and private transactions. A fork of Bytecoin, Monero is built on the CryptoNote protocol and uses a number of features to obscure the origin, amount and destination of transactions.

Monero is built with privacy as a core principle, using advanced cryptographic techniques like ring signatures and stealth addresses to keep transaction details confidential. This contrasts with Bitcoin, where transactions are transparent and traceable on the blockchain.
